Most water heater replacements in Curtis Park take 3-5 hours from start to finish, depending on your specific situation. If we’re replacing a tank with a similar tank in the same location, it’s typically on the shorter end.
Tankless water heater installations may take longer, especially if we need to upgrade gas lines or electrical connections. We handle all permit requirements beforehand, so there are no delays waiting for approvals.

The best choice depends on your household’s hot water usage, available space, and budget. Traditional tank water heaters cost less upfront and work well for most Curtis Park homes with moderate hot water needs.
Tankless water heaters cost more initially but provide endless hot water, take up minimal space, and reduce energy costs long-term. They’re ideal for Curtis Park homes with limited space or high hot water demand.

If your water heater is over 8-10 years old and having multiple issues, replacement usually makes more financial sense than repeated repairs. Signs you likely need replacement include rusty water, strange noises, frequent temperature fluctuations, or visible leaks from the tank.
However, newer units with minor issues can often be repaired cost-effectively. We’ll give you honest advice about whether repair or replacement makes more sense for your specific situation.
